Easy Crockpot Chicken Taco Recipe


Are you looking for a simple and delicious meal that you can set and forget? The Easy Crockpot Chicken Taco recipe is perfect for busy days! With just a few ingredients and minimal preparation, you can have a tasty dinner ready when you get home.

How to Make Easy Crockpot Chicken Taco

Ingredients:

  • 1 lb chicken breast
  • 1 can diced tomatoes
  • 1 can black beans
  • 1 cup corn
  • 1 packet taco seasoning
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Directions:

  1. Place the chicken breasts in the crockpot.
  2. Add the diced tomatoes, black beans, corn, and taco seasoning.
  3. Stir to combine.
  4. Cook on low for 6-8 hours or high for 3-4 hours.
  5. Before serving, shred the chicken with two forks and stir to mix everything. Serve with rice or tortillas.

How to Serve Easy Crockpot Chicken Taco

Serve this dish with warm tortillas, over rice, or even in a taco bowl with your favorite toppings like cheese, avocado, sour cream, or chopped cilantro. It’s versatile and can be enjoyed in many ways!

How to Store Easy Crockpot Chicken Taco

If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. You can also freeze the dish for later use. Just make sure to let it cool completely before putting it in the freezer.

Tips to Make Easy Crockpot Chicken Taco

  • For extra flavor, add some chopped onions or bell peppers to the mix.
  • If you like it spicy, add some chopped jalapeños or a dash of hot sauce.
  • To make it even quicker, use frozen corn or canned beans that are already rinsed and drained.

Variation

If you want a different twist, you can substitute the chicken with ground beef or turkey. You can also add other veggies like zucchini or bell peppers for added nutrition.

FAQs

1. Can I use frozen chicken?

Yes, you can use frozen chicken breasts. Just make sure to cook it for a longer time to ensure it’s fully cooked.

2. Is this recipe gluten-free?

Yes, as long as you use a gluten-free taco seasoning, this recipe can be gluten-free.

3. How can I make it healthier?

You can add more vegetables or use low-sodium canned tomatoes and beans to make it healthier.
